Valpo Takes Fourth Place at Central Collegiate Championships
Saturday, April 22, 2006
Valparaiso took to the track in Ypsilanti, Mich. Saturday, and brought home a fourth place finish at the Central Collegiate Championships, hosted by Eastern Michigan.

The Crusaders tallied 44 points on the meet. Michigan took top team honors with 270 points.

Steve Bartholomew (Valparaiso, Ind./Morgan Township H.S.) led the way for the Brown and Gold with two fourth-place finishes. Bartholomew earned his finishes with tosses of 158'3" in the discus and 176'10" in the hammer throw.

Erik Lindamood (Bealeton, Va./Liberty H.S.) had a strong performance in the shot put. Lindamood had a best effort of 45'1 ¾", good for seventh place.

Rich Krupar (Elyria, Ohio/Midview H.S.) led three Valpo runners taking part in the 3,000m steeplechase. Krupar crossed the line in fifth position, covering the course in 10:14.16.

The Crusaders placed two runners in the top ten in the 5,000m run. David Wheeler (Saint Charles, Ill./East H.S.) placed seventh in 15:42.44, while Jordan Stanfill (Goshen, Ind./Goshen H.S.) followed in 15:55.66, finishing in ninth place.

Valparaiso will return to the track Saturday, April 29, heading to Iowa to take part in the Drake Relays. The first event is scheduled for a 2:15 p.m. CDT start.
